第14章音Sound原書 p.431–472
Key Terms重要語
amplitude the amount that matter is disrupted during a sound wave, as measured by the difference in height between the crests and troughs of the sound wave.
振幅 音波のあいだに物質が乱される量。音波の山と谷の高さの差で測られる
beat a phenomenon produced by the superposition of two waves with slightly different frequencies but the same amplitude
うなり 振動数がわずかに違い振幅は同じ二つの波の重ね合わせで生じる現象
beat frequency the frequency of the amplitude fluctuations of a wave
うなりの振動数 波の振幅の揺らぎの振動数
damping the reduction in amplitude over time as the energy of an oscillation dissipates
減衰 振動のエネルギーが散るにつれて振幅が時間とともに減ること
decibel a unit used to describe sound intensity levels
デシベル 音の強さのレベルを表すのに使われる単位
Doppler effect an alteration in the observed frequency of a sound due to relative motion between the source and the observer
ドップラー効果 源と観測者の間の相対運動によって、観測される音の振動数が変わること
fundamental the lowest-frequency resonance
基本音 最も低い振動数の共鳴
harmonics the term used to refer to the fundamental and its overtones
倍音 基本音とその上音を指すのに使われる語
hearing the perception of sound
聴覚 音を感じ取ること
